New Delhi: World Championships silver-medallist Saweety Boora (81kg) was the lone Indian to make the finals as five others settled for bronze medals after losing in the semifinals of the Asian Women's Boxing Championships in Wulanchabu, China.

Saweety defeated Uzbekistan's Dilnovaz Narkhodzhayeva 3-0 to set up a clash with home favourite Yang Xiaoli, who got the better of Kazakhstan's Moldir Bazarbayeva 2-1 in her last-four stage bout.

However, the rest of the Indians in action fell by the wayside in the semifinals.

In the 54kg division, Meena Kumari was outpunched 0-3 by Filipino Nesty Petecio.World Championships silver-medallist Sarjubala Shamjetsabam (48kg) also went down by a similar margin to China's E Naiyan.

Pwilao Basumatary (57kg) and Seema Punia, too, met a similar fate. While Basumatary lost 0-3 to Thailand's Tassamelee Thongjan, Punia bowed out after being beaten 0-3 by China's Wang Shijin.
